[Libclc-dev] [PATCH 1/8] Fix implementation of length builtin
Tom Stellard
thomas.stellard at amd.com
Fri Mar 6 17:01:28 PST 2015
The new implementation was ported from the AMD builtin library
and has been tested with piglit, OpenCV, and the ocl conformance tests.
---
generic/lib/geometric/length.cl | 120 ++++++++++++++++++++++++++++++++++++++-
generic/lib/geometric/length.inc | 3 -
2 files changed, 117 insertions(+), 6 deletions(-)
delete mode 100644 generic/lib/geometric/length.inc
diff --git a/generic/lib/geometric/length.cl b/generic/lib/geometric/length.cl
index ef087c7..3037372 100644
--- a/generic/lib/geometric/length.cl
+++ b/generic/lib/geometric/length.cl
@@ -1,8 +1,122 @@

#include <clc/clc.h>
+_CLC_OVERLOAD _CLC_DEF float length(float p) {
+ return fabs(p);
+}
+
+_CLC_OVERLOAD _CLC_DEF float length(float2 p) {
+ float l2 = dot(p, p);
+
+ if (l2 < FLT_MIN) {
+ p *= 0x1.0p+86F;
+ return sqrt(dot(p, p)) * 0x1.0p-86F;
+ } else if (l2 == INFINITY) {
+ p *= 0x1.0p-65F;
+ return sqrt(dot(p, p)) * 0x1.0p+65F;
+ }
+
+ return sqrt(l2);
+}
+
+_CLC_OVERLOAD _CLC_DEF float length(float3 p) {
+ float l2 = dot(p, p);
+
+ if (l2 < FLT_MIN) {
+ p *= 0x1.0p+86F;
+ return sqrt(dot(p, p)) * 0x1.0p-86F;
+ } else if (l2 == INFINITY) {
+ p *= 0x1.0p-66F;
+ return sqrt(dot(p, p)) * 0x1.0p+66F;
+ }
+
+ return sqrt(l2);
+}
+
+_CLC_OVERLOAD _CLC_DEF float length(float4 p) {
+ float l2 = dot(p, p);
+
+ if (l2 < FLT_MIN) {
+ p *= 0x1.0p+86F;
+ return sqrt(dot(p, p)) * 0x1.0p-86F;
+ } else if (l2 == INFINITY) {
+ p *= 0x1.0p-66f;
+ return sqrt(dot(p, p)) * 0x1.0p+66F;
+ }
+ return sqrt(l2);
+}
+
#ifdef cl_khr_fp64
#pragma OPENCL EXTENSION cl_khr_fp64 : enable
-#endif
-#define __CLC_BODY <length.inc>
-#include <clc/geometric/floatn.inc>
+_CLC_OVERLOAD _CLC_DEF double length(double p){
+ return fabs(p);
+}
+
+_CLC_OVERLOAD _CLC_DEF double length(double2 p) {
+ double l2 = dot(p, p);
+
+ if (l2 < DBL_MIN) {
+ p *= 0x1.0p+563;
+ return sqrt(dot(p, p)) * 0x1.0p-563;
+ } else if (l2 == INFINITY) {
+ p *= 0x1.0p-513;
+ return sqrt(dot(p, p)) * 0x1.0p+513;
+ }
+
+ return sqrt(l2);
+}
+
+_CLC_OVERLOAD _CLC_DEF double length(double3 p) {
+ double l2 = dot(p, p);
+
+ if (l2 < DBL_MIN) {
+ p *= 0x1.0p+563;
+ return sqrt(dot(p, p)) * 0x1.0p-563;
+ } else if (l2 == INFINITY) {
+ p *= 0x1.0p-514;
+ return sqrt(dot(p, p)) * 0x1.0p+514;
+ }
+
+ return sqrt(l2);
+}
+
+_CLC_OVERLOAD _CLC_DEF double
+length(double4 p)
+{
+ double l2 = dot(p, p);
+
+ if (l2 < DBL_MIN) {
+ p *= 0x1.0p+563;
+ return sqrt(dot(p, p)) * 0x1.0p-563;
+ }
+ else if (l2 == INFINITY) {
+ p *= 0x1.0p-514;
+ return sqrt(dot(p, p)) * 0x1.0p+514;
+ }
+
+ return sqrt(l2);
+}
+
+#endif
diff --git a/generic/lib/geometric/length.inc b/generic/lib/geometric/length.inc
deleted file mode 100644
index 5faaaff..0000000
--- a/generic/lib/geometric/length.inc
+++ /dev/null
@@ -1,3 +0,0 @@
-_CLC_OVERLOAD _CLC_DEF __CLC_FLOAT length(__CLC_FLOATN p) {
- return native_sqrt(dot(p, p));
-}
